Placements: 75-80% percent of students are placed in my course. The highest package offered is 9 LPA. The lowest package offered is 4 LPA. And average package offered is 6 LPA. The recruiting companies are Tata Group and General Motors. Top roles like tool engineer; around 65% percent of students got internships.
Infrastructure: The infrastructure and facilities are excellent in the college. The college provides Wi-Fi with high-speed internet connection. The labs are well-equipped, the classrooms are very big, and 2 seminar halls are available. All books are available in the library. The hostel facilities are good. Canteen food is good.
Faculty: The teachers are well-qualified. They have 10 years of experience. They have completed their Masters and are extraordinarily knowledgeable. They teach in a good manner. All the teachers are very good. The course curriculum is superb. The semester exams are easy in this college, and 70% is the pass percentage.

I had a wonderful 4 years of experience.
Placements: Even during the pandemic, almost 50% of the students got placed from here. The highest salary package offered is unknown. Companies like TCS, Infosys, Bosch and Autoliv had visited the campus. Every student got an internship as it was compulsory. Graduate engineer trainee was the highest role offered.
Infrastructure: The classrooms and library were air-conditioned and were best in class here. Wi-Fi access was limited. The hostel was the best with an attached bathroom. There were 2 and 3 sharing options. The mess also serves food on time. The campus had a gym facility, and it also had a visiting doctor.
Faculty: The teachers here were adequately qualified. Their teaching quality was good. The course curriculum is prescribed by VTU, and hence it's the same for all engineering colleges. A few new subject electives were relevant to current industry trends. The difficulty of exams was high and low depending on the subject. The pass percentage was above average.
Other: I chose this course because mechanical engineering is evergreen. The best thing about this course was the amount of problem-solving involved. More practicals need to be included in this course, and the curriculum must give equal weightage to all activities instead of only final exams. The fest was the best part of the college. It had lots of celebrity concerts and was an enjoyable experience.

Placements: It is a good college for software engineers but is bad for mechanical, and civil engineers. The college is not fair as it takes 200 mechanical engineering students every year if they can't even place 30 in core companies.
Infrastructure: The infrastructure of the college is good, but you can't study in air-conditioned classrooms before exams. All the air-conditioners were switched off by the management during breaks. We were supposed to sit during breaks without air-conditioners and have lunch in a classroom without windows.
Faculty: Colleges affiliated to VTU are concerned about completing portions and nothing else. I won't blame lecturers but never join VTU as they are interested in completing the assignments which give zero knowledge. The college should give us quality assignments, and not quantity.
Other: Extracurricular activities like Baja, Formula, etc., were organised and I like them. But it was not possible for day scholars.

Placements: About 500 students get placed every year. Companies like TCS, Infosys, Bosch, Mahindra, etc., visit our campus for placements. The highest salary package offered is about 5 to 6 LPA. The lowest salary package offered is 1.2 LPA. Intershala offers internships, or we should find out ourselves for an internship in any company.
Infrastructure: Facilities in our college are good. The library is huge and equipped with many books. The campus is huge and lush green. There is a huge cricket ground, basketball ground, badminton ground. Classrooms are equipped with air-conditioners after the 1st year. Labs are very good and well-maintained. The hostel is very good. There is air-conditioner and non-air-conditioner facility available. The college imposes strict rules, and that should be followed.
Faculty: Teachers in our college are very good and well-qualified. They help us in any situations. They are very friendly and share good knowledge with us. Teaching is very good for mechanical branch, and I don't know about others. Students are not much industry-ready, but somewhat they will make you industry-ready. We should also study other things extra from online so that we are up to date.
Other: I have chosen this course as I like mechanics. Labs are best. The course should be updated so that we can learn about nowadays mechanics. The biggest fest, called Sentia, is organised in our college every year in March. Other functions like branch entry, freshers day, Onam, tech talks, workshops, IoTs, etc., are organised here.

Placements: Nearly 10% of the students got placed in our course. The highest salary offered was about Rs. 2,00,000 per month, the lowest salary offered was about Rs. 25,000 per month and the average salary offered was about Rs. 40,000 per month. Top recruiting companies are Mahindra, Infosys. The top roles offered were manager, executor etc. The highest salary package offered was 10 LPA for eight students, the lowest salary package offered was about 2 LPA for eight students, and the average salary package offered was about 4 LPA for eight people. Every student gets an internship from companies like Mahindra, Tata and some local industry.
Infrastructure: MITE college consists of three buildings, one of them was the main building, the other one is a post-graduation block, and the last one was a mechanical block. The infrastructure is good, and classrooms are air-conditioned, and there is a projector facility. Wi-Fi facility is not available. Libraries and labs are available and are in good condition. The facilities provided in the hostel are good, but the quality of the food is just okay. Medical facilities are available, sports and games are conducting only once that is on sports day.
Faculty: Teachers are helpful, qualified. But some teachers threaten the students by not giving attendance and holding back the student marks. The teaching quality is good, but I feel it's an old method to study in this condition. The course curriculum is relevant, but it doesn't make students industry-ready. The activities like internships, the industrial visit makes them industry-ready.
